DEFECT #1 - F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:STORAGE:TANK ASSEMBLY


Posted on: 2000-10-24
Description
Vehicle description: certain passenger v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of fmvss no.  301, fuel system integrity.  These vehicles were built with an inadequate vent valve weld on the top portion of the fuel tank.

Consequence
Fuel spillage could occur during refueling or if the vehicle were involved in a rollover.  If an ignition source were present, a fire could occur.

Corrective Action
Dealers will inspect the vehicle to ensure the fuel tank vent valve is properly welded.  If necessary, dealers will replace the fuel tank assembly.

DEFECT #2 - POWER TRAIN:A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ION:PARK/NEUTRAL START SWITCH


Posted on: 2000-10-24
Description
Vehicle description: certain passenger vehicles, equipped with automatic transaxles, fail to comply with the requirements of fmvss no.  114, theft protection.  These vehicles were built with an improperly adjusted automatic transaxle park lock cable assembly.  If improperly adjusted, it is possible to shift from the park position with the ignition key removed.

Consequence
This condition increases the risk of a crash resulting from the unintended movement of parked vehicles.

Corrective Action
Saturn is asking owners and retailers to perform a functional check of the automatic transaxle park lock cable assembly operation, and if necessary, to have the cable adjusted.  If owners are not comfortable performing the functional check themselves, they can have their dealer perform this inspection for them.
